Mechanism of Action

Thermal Ablation and Collagen Stimulation

The primary mechanism by which fractional CO2 laser therapy operates is through thermal ablation. When the laser is applied to the skin, it generates heat that vaporizes damaged cells in the targeted area. This process creates micro-injuries, which, although controlled, trigger the body’s natural healing response. The result is an increase in collagen and elastin production—two vital proteins that contribute to skin structure and elasticity.

As the body repairs these micro-injuries, new, healthier skin cells are formed, leading to improved texture and tone. This collagen remodeling process is particularly beneficial for treating signs of aging and other skin imperfections.

Addressing Specific Skin Concerns

Fractional CO2 laser therapy is versatile and can be customized to target various skin issues effectively. Here are some specific conditions that can benefit from this treatment:

1. Fine Lines and Wrinkles

As we age, the skin loses collagen and elasticity, resulting in fine lines and wrinkles. Fractional CO2 laser therapy stimulates collagen production, promoting a smoother appearance. By focusing on areas around the eyes, mouth, and forehead, practitioners can significantly reduce the appearance of these aging signs, restoring a more youthful look.

2. Acne Scars

Acne scars can be a lasting reminder of skin blemishes. Fractional CO2 lasers effectively target the texture and pigmentation of these scars. The laser energy helps break down the scar tissue and encourages the formation of new, healthy skin, reducing the visibility of acne scars over time.

3. Sun Damage and Hyperpigmentation

Excessive sun exposure can lead to skin damage, including sunspots and uneven pigmentation. Fractional CO2 laser therapy targets these issues by breaking down melanin deposits in the skin. As the skin heals, the appearance of hyperpigmented areas diminishes, leading to a more even skin tone.

4. Enlarged Pores

Enlarged pores can be a concern for many individuals, often making the skin appear uneven. Fractional CO2 lasers can help improve the appearance of pores by stimulating collagen production around the pore area. This tightening effect can lead to a smoother skin texture.

The Treatment Process

Consultation and Assessment

Before undergoing fractional CO2 laser therapy, it is vital to have a thorough consultation with a qualified dermatologist. During this appointment, the practitioner will evaluate your skin type, discuss your concerns, and develop a personalized treatment plan. This assessment is crucial to ensure the best outcomes tailored to individual needs.

Pre-Treatment Preparation

Prior to the procedure, patients are typically advised to avoid sun exposure and certain medications that could increase skin sensitivity. Following pre-treatment instructions is essential for minimizing risks and maximizing the effectiveness of the therapy.

The Procedure

On the day of the treatment, the dermatologist will cleanse the skin and apply a topical numbing agent to enhance comfort. The actual procedure usually lasts between 30 minutes to an hour, depending on the areas being treated. During the session, the practitioner will use the fractional CO2 laser device, moving it across the skin to create the desired treatment zones.

Post-Treatment Care

After the procedure, patients may experience redness, swelling, and a sensation similar to a mild sunburn. These effects are temporary and typically subside within a few days. Proper post-treatment care is vital for optimal healing and results. Patients are usually advised to keep the treated area moisturized, avoid sun exposure, and follow any specific skincare recommendations given by their dermatologist.

Expected Results

Initial Improvements

Patients often notice initial improvements in their skin texture and tone within a few weeks after treatment. However, the most significant results typically develop over several months as collagen production continues and the skin heals. Many individuals report enhanced skin quality, with a reduction in fine lines, scars, and pigmentation irregularities.

Long-Term Maintenance

To maintain the results achieved through fractional CO2 laser therapy, patients may benefit from periodic touch-up sessions. A consistent skincare routine that includes sun protection and moisturizing can further enhance and prolong the benefits of the treatment.
